Katrina owns a fitness center and provides a juice bar that serves refreshments to members after their workouts. Which type of n

oncommercial food service operation is this juice bar? A. employers B. educational institutions C. other D. healthcare
Health
1 answer:
vova2212 [387]3 years ago
6 0

Answer: The correct answer is "Other".

Explanation:

Since Karina owns the fitness center and provides a juice bar to her clients after their workouts, she is operating a noncommercial food service.It does not fall under healthcare, since there is no hospital or medical reasoning for the juice bar except to provide refreshment. The juice bar is not just for her employers or employees, since it states this is for members. It is not an educational food service since there is no school or classes being taught.

Is a cheetahs speed a biological adaptation or a behavioral adaptation or both
andrey2020 [161]

Answer:

Cheetahs have paws that are narrower than other large felids, resembling the paws of dogs rather than cats. During fast sprints, a cheetah's paws have minimal contact with the ground.

Cheetahs have claws that are blunt, slightly curved, and only semi-retractable. Cheetah claws are like running spikes, used to increase traction while pursuing prey. Ridges running along the footpads act like tire treads for additional traction.

Cheetahs have a curved dewclaw on their forelegs. While in pursuit, as a cheetah nears its target, it will swat and trip the prey animal with its dewclaw.Explanation:
